| 1 | RGUTUSR ;CAIRO/DKM - Parse recipient list;04-Sep-1998 11:26;DKM | 
|---|
| 2 | ;;2.1;RUN TIME LIBRARY;;Mar 22, 1999 | 
|---|
| 3 | ;================================================================= | 
|---|
| 4 | ; Takes a list of recipients (which may be DUZ #'s, names, | 
|---|
| 5 | ; mail groups, or special tokens) as input and produces an | 
|---|
| 6 | ; array of DUZ's as output.  If a list element is found in | 
|---|
| 7 | ; in the token list RGLST, the value of the token entry will | 
|---|
| 8 | ; be substituted. | 
|---|
| 9 | ; Inputs: | 
|---|
| 10 | ;     RGUSR = Semicolon-delimited list of recipients | 
|---|
| 11 | ;     RGLST = Special token list | 
|---|
| 12 | ; Outputs: | 
|---|
| 13 | ;     RGOUT = Local array to receive DUZ list | 
|---|
| 14 | ;================================================================= |
